A famille rose 'peach' vase, late Qing dynasty/Republic.

Of baluster shape, decorated in famille rose with peaches. Height 29 cm.

Cover restored.

The peach is one of the san duo or three abundances and has been chosen for its symbolic meaning. It is a wish for an abundance of years, or long life.
